Outcome of Rio+20- a set of Sustainable
Development Goals- SDGs• Address and incorporate the three dimensions sustainability
• Be based on Agenda 21 and the Johannesburg Plan of
Implementation
• Build upon achievement & lessons learned from the MDGs
• Focus on priority areas for the achievement of sustainable
development

Sustainable Development Goals must be• Action-oriented
• Concise
• Limited in number
• Aspirational
• Universally applicable to all countries
• Easy the communicate
Post-MDGs Track
Consultations on the post-development framework
replacing the MDGs when they expire in 2015
Post-MDGs Key Reports & ConsultationsLed by UN Secretary-General
• High Level Panel of Eminent Persons
• Sustainable Development Solutions Network
• UN Global Compact Consultations
• UNDP Thematic and National Consultations
SDGs Intergovernmental ProcessLed by the Open Working Group mandated by Rio+20 to prepare
a proposal on SDGs for consideration by the General Assembly
Post-2015 Development Agenda A Single Framework and a Single Set of Goals
SDGs Post-MDGsEnsuring Sustainable Development Overcoming Poverty and Insecurity
